Markovate vs InData Labs: overview
Markovate
Markovate has stayed narrowly focused on AI and machine learning product work since founding in 2015, running a team in the 51-200 range out of San Francisco. Co-founder Rajeev Sharma built the firm around shipping AI products end to end rather than staffing generic development teams, which shows in how consistently its case studies center on generative AI and applied ML rather than a broader software portfolio. That narrowness is a trade-off: less flexibility for non-AI work, more depth on the thing it actually does.
InData Labs
InData Labs traces its founding to 2014 and gaming-industry veteran Marat Karpeko, with headquarters in Cyprus and additional offices reported in Lithuania and the US. Reported staff counts swing between roughly 65 and 200 across different trackers, common for firms mixing core employees with project-based contractors. The firm's practice centers on data science: predictive analytics, natural language processing, computer vision, and large-scale data analytics, positioning it closer to a data-first consultancy than a generative-AI-branded shop.
